AT&T’s off-again, on-again free WiFi for iPhonesIt’s on-again!

Update: It’s OFF again.

For those that haven’t been following the drama (shame on you!) here’s the scoop. AT&T last Thursday began trials of free WiFi service for iPhone users – and people picked up on it pretty fast. It was suspicious though because there was no mention of it from either AT&T or Apple.

Then on 04 May AT&T removed the free WiFi access – much to the dismay of iPhone users everywhere.

Well, today the service is back and it’s official.

According to MacRumors AT&T’s iPhone website (under ‘Plans’ tab) has been updated to reveal that each iPhone plan now includes access to their “more than 17,000 Wi-Fi hotspots, including Starbucks all for use in the U.S.”
